How Much Are Closing Costs on a Home in Frisco, Michigan?
Closing costs are a crucial part of buying a home in Frisco, Michigan. According to Sonic Loans experts who serve Frisco and Metro Detroit, these costs typically range from 2% to 5% of the home's purchase price. On a $280,000 home, this means you can expect to pay between $5,600 and $14,000. At Sonic Loans, we frequently hear this question from homebuyers looking to budget accurately. How Closing Costs Work in Frisco, Michigan
Key Details and Process Steps
Closing costs encompass a variety of fees. Here’s a breakdown:
- Origination Fees: Charged by the lender for processing the loan application. These fees cover the lender's administrative costs and can vary based on the loan amount. In Frisco, these fees are typically competitive, reflecting the local market's standards.
- Title Insurance: Protects against disputes over the property’s ownership. This insurance is crucial in safeguarding your investment from potential legal issues. It's a one-time fee that can save you from costly legal battles in the future.
- Appraisal Fees: Covers the cost of assessing the home’s value. An accurate appraisal ensures you are paying a fair price for the property. This step is vital in Frisco's market, where property values can fluctuate.
- Prepaid Taxes and Insurance: Includes property taxes and homeowner’s insurance premiums. These prepayments are necessary to establish an escrow account for future payments. This ensures that your taxes and insurance are covered, providing peace of mind.
These costs are typically paid at the closing meeting, where the final paperwork is signed, and the property ownership is transferred. It's important to note that some fees may be negotiable, and understanding this can help you save money. Knowing which fees can be negotiated can lead to significant savings.

Common Mistakes and Expert Tips
Mistakes to Avoid
One common mistake is underestimating the total closing costs. Buyers often focus solely on the down payment, overlooking these additional expenses. Another pitfall is not reviewing the Loan Estimate thoroughly, which can lead to unexpected costs at closing. Lastly, failing to budget for these costs can strain your finances unexpectedly. It's also essential to compare different lenders, as fees can vary significantly. Ignoring this step might lead to paying more than necessary.
